Recent Yen Rally Puts These 3 ETFs in Focus
The Japanese yen strengthened sharply against the U.S. dollar on September 3, 2026, driven by hawkish comments from Bank of Japan officials and expectations of rate hikes. A coordinated U.S.-Japan intervention on July 30, 2026 supported the yen while using FIMA repos to avoid Treasury selling pressure. The stronger yen benefits currency ETFs but pressures export-heavy Japan equities and could eventually hurt U.S. Treasury ETFs if BOJ rate hikes trigger capital repatriation.
Is WisdomTree Japan Opportunities Fund (OPPJ) a Strong ETF Right Now?
The WisdomTree Japan Opportunities Fund (OPPJ) is reviewed as a smart beta ETF providing exposure to Japanese companies with year-to-date returns of 27.21% and 12-month returns of 45.55%. With $287.39 million in assets and a 0.58% expense ratio, it offers reasonable diversification with 92 holdings. However, alternatives like JPMorgan BetaBuilders Japan ETF (BBJP) and iShares MSCI Japan ETF (EWJ) provide lower expense ratios and larger asset bases for investors seeking cheaper options.
Despite the Weakening Yen, Japan's Stock Market Is Outperforming. Here's How to Invest.
Japan's stock market is up 19% year-to-date, outperforming the S&P 500's 13% gain, driven by a weak yen that boosts exports and strong economic growth. Key sectors include technology, financials, and industrials. While Japanese exporters benefit from currency weakness, the country's heavy dependence on imported oil poses a significant economic risk.
